Navigating the DevOps World: A Comprehensive Career Guide

Embarking on a career in DevOps can be both rewarding, but also challenging. This dynamic field blends building and IT services to deliver accelerated software release. To prosper in this landscape, aspiring DevOps professionals must cultivate a diverse set of proficiencies.

  • Basic software engineering skills in languages like Python, Java, or Go are critical.
  • Workflow automation tools such as Ansible, Puppet, or Chef are indispensable to streamline repetitive tasks.
  • Cloud knowledge, including AWS, Azure, or GCP, is vital.

Seamless integration and deployment require a deep understanding of tools like Jenkins, GitLab CI, or CircleCI.

Staying informed with the latest technologies in DevOps is critical for long-term advancement.
